I decided to colour up Zoe, from Saturated Canary, with distress inks to match these gorgeous papers that came in my Dies to Die for DT pack.  I have had to restrain myself from buying a pad of these simply because I have so much paper and so little space lol, but honestly I'm not sure how long I'll be able to resist, they are sooooo pretty and so versatile!


Instead of putting the usual tag or label shape in the middle to old the 'easel' back, I decided to carry on the photography theme on the front to the inside and used these die cuts at the sides to lock the card behind, I'm quite pleased with how it came out.


Zoe is such a gorgeous image,  this digi cames in a pack of 5 and they are all gorgeous!  I blew her up reasonably large and cropped her, then once she was coloured in I fussy cut her and placed her so she looks like she is about to step out of a photo.  The polaroid die and all the accessory dies came from the .....La-La Land Club Kit.
